The 7th Precinct is seeking a qualified candidate for the position of School Crossing Guard Level II, Supervisor. This position will be responsible for supervising all school crossing guards assigned to the 7th Precinct, monitoring attendance, work assignments, and schedules for school crossing guards. The selected candidate will also be responsible for transporting crossing guards to and from uncovered posts, preparing reports, forms, memos, lists, cards, and conducting training and evaluations of school crossing guards. Must be capable of performing required tours and duties within the assigned borough.

RESIDENCY REQUIREMENT:
New York City residency is generally required within 90 days of appointment. However, City Employees in certain titles who have worked for the City for 2 continuous years may also be eligible to reside in Nassau, Suffolk, Putnam, Westchester, Rockland, or Orange County. To determine if the residency requirement applies to you, please discuss with the agency representative at the time of the interview.
